One of the key trends in the laboratory accessories market is the increasing demand for automation and digitalization. As laboratories and research facilities seek to improve efficiency and accuracy, automated systems are being integrated into lab operations. This includes the use of robotic arms for repetitive tasks, automated sample analysis, and digital lab management software. These innovations are driving the demand for accessories that are compatible with automated systems, such as sensors, digital pipettes, and automated laboratory equipment. The growing adoption of these technologies across various research disciplines is reshaping the landscape of the laboratory accessories market.
Another significant trend is the rising focus on sustainability in laboratory operations. Researchers and institutions are becoming more environmentally conscious and are adopting eco-friendly practices in their labs. This includes the use of recyclable lab materials, energy-efficient equipment, and green chemicals. As a result, there is an increasing demand for laboratory accessories that are not only effective but also sustainable. Manufacturers are responding to this trend by developing environmentally friendly products, such as biodegradable lab consumables and energy-efficient instruments. The push towards sustainability is expected to play a pivotal role in shaping the future of the laboratory accessories market.
